Lipid-lowering medications that inhibit the activity of 3-hydroxy-3-methylglutaryl (HMG)-coenzyme A (CoA) reductase (statins), a critical enzyme in both cholesterol and coenzyme Q 10 biosynthesis, decrease plasma coenzyme Q 10 concentrations (see HMG-CoA reductase inhibitors [statins]), although it remains unproven that this has any clinical implications
